    Our Essential Duties and Responsibilities

    • Build and install iron or steel girders, columns and other construction materials to form buildings, bridges and other structures
    • Cut, position and bolt down steel bars to reinforce concrete
    • Repair older infrastructure
    • Make, weld and cut structural metal
    • Erect steel frames
    • Direct operation of cranes to move structural steel, reinforcing bars and other materials onto and around the construction site
    • Connect steel columns, beams and girders
    • Drill holes into steel for bolts
    • Number steel according to assembly instructions
    • Unload and stack steel
    • Attach cables to steel and then to the crane
    • Hoist steel into place in the framework
    • Position steel with connecting bars and spud wrenches
    • Work with driftpins to align the holes in the steel with the framework holes
    • Use plumb bobs, levels and laser equipment to check alignment
    • Bolt or weld piece into place
    • Set reinforcing bars into forms to hold concrete
    • Fasten bars together with wire
    • Place spacers under rebar to lift bars off deck
    • Cut bars with metal shears and torches
    • Reinforce concrete with welded wire fabric
    • Substitute cables for rebar
    • Tighten cables with jacking equipment
    • Install stairs, handrails or curtain walls
    • Make sure all pieces are fitted properly and complete repairs as necessary
